Ingredients Breakdown
Fritos Corn Salad consists of a few key ingredients. The base is made up of canned or frozen corn, which provides a natural sweetness and texture. Fritos corn chips are crushed and mixed into the salad, adding a salty crunch that contrasts with the creamy dressing. The dressing typically includes mayonnaise, sour cream, and ranch seasoning, giving the salad a rich and tangy flavor. Additional ingredients may include diced bell peppers, green onions, or even jalapeños to add color and a bit of heat. The salad is often garnished with extra Fritos on top for an added crunch.

Step-by-Step Recipe
Start by draining and rinsing the corn if using canned corn, or cook and cool frozen corn. In a large bowl, combine the corn, crushed Fritos chips, diced bell pepper, green onions, and any other optional vegetables. In a separate bowl, mix together the mayonnaise, sour cream, ranch seasoning, salt, and pepper until smooth. Pour the dressing over the corn mixture and toss gently to coat all the ingredients evenly. Taste and adjust seasoning if needed. Cover the salad and refrigerate it for at least an hour before serving, allowing the flavors to meld together. Garnish with additional Fritos chips just before serving for extra crunch.

Tips for the Perfect Fritos Corn Salad
For the best flavor, use fresh corn when it’s in season, but frozen or canned corn works well year-round. Be sure to refrigerate the salad for at least an hour before serving to allow the flavors to combine and the salad to chill. When adding Fritos chips, it’s important to add them just before serving to maintain their crunch. If you prefer a spicier version, consider adding diced jalapeños or a bit of hot sauce to the dressing. For a healthier alternative, you can use Greek yogurt instead of sour cream and light mayo in the dressing.

FAQ

  1. Can I make Fritos Corn Salad ahead of time?
    Yes, Fritos Corn Salad can be made ahead of time and stored in the refrigerator for up to 2 days. Just be sure to add the Fritos chips right before serving to maintain their crunch.
  2. Can I use fresh corn instead of canned or frozen?
    Absolutely! Fresh corn adds a great sweetness and texture to the salad. Simply cook the corn and let it cool before mixing it with the other ingredients.
  3. Can I add protein to Fritos Corn Salad?
    Yes, you can add protein to make the salad more filling. Grilled chicken, shrimp, or even bacon bits can be great additions.
  4. Is there a dairy-free version of this salad?
    Yes, you can make a dairy-free version of the salad by using vegan mayo and sour cream alternatives. Be sure to check that the Fritos chips you use are dairy-free as well.

Fritos corn salad

Fritos Corn Salad is a creamy, crunchy, and flavorful side dish made with corn, Fritos chips, and a tangy dressing. It’s perfect for barbecues, picnics, or potlucks and can be easily customized to suit your tastes.
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 10 minutes
Servings 7

Ingredients
  

  • 2 15 ounce cans whole kernel corn, drained
  • 2 cups grated cheddar cheese
  • 1 cup mayonnaise
  • 1 cup chopped green pepper
  • 1/2 cup finely diced red onion
  • 1 10 1/2 ounce bag regular Fritos corn chips, coarsely crushed, or Fritos chili cheese corn chips
  • Fritos Scoops for serving

Instructions
 

  • Combine the first five ingredients and refrigerate. Just before serving, stir in the corn chips. You might not need to add all the chips—add them gradually. Some people prefer to serve the Fritos on the side or crumbled on top. This can be eaten with a spoon or enjoyed as a dip with Fritos Scoops for serving.

Notes

For more color, use both red and green peppers.
You don’t need to add all the crushed Fritos—just add until you reach your desired consistency.
